The role involves developing and improving multi-axis CMM-Inspection programming, setting up and operating manufacturing CMM and equipment to support business goals. The position requires working with blueprints, CAD models, sketches, engineering drawings, and verbal instructions to produce hardware. Responsibilities include performing dimensional checks using measurement equipment/gages, troubleshooting process issues, and creating/revising planning for production and development processes. The role also involves providing collaboration, direction, and support to manufacturing employees, data collection, analysis, and validation, as well as training duties. Additional responsibilities include providing environmental, health, safety, maintenance, quality, continuous improvement, and production flow job duties in support of manufacturing-related initiatives and programs, and maintaining detailed job task documentation, reports, and records.
